National Technology Audit Programme - Ireland
The National Technology Audit Programme (Ireland) is a national programme designed to help Irish manufacturers exploit more effectively the technological and commercial opportunities available to them. The programme, which is part-funded by the European Regional Development Fund (ERDF), is administered by Forbairt, the Irish State Development Agency. The programme is essentially aimed at small companies - employing less than 50 people and with an annual turnover of less than 3 million Irish pounds. By the end of 1995, more than 650 companies had accessed the programme. A similar programme, based on the Irish experience, has also been launched in Greece as a result of collaboration between the national state development bodies.
